Fencing costs are just one of one of the most pricey aspects of animals grazing. The type of fence created substantially affects the expense per foot, total expense, as well as annual ownership cost. In addition, the form of the paddocks impacts the quantity of materials needed and labor needed for building of the fencing.
These are: woven cord, barbed cable, high-tensile non-electric, high-tensile electrified and also short-lived indoor fencing. The kind of fencing chosen varies by individual choice and the types of animals to be confined. As a whole all arrangements shown can be used with livestock, woven cable and also high-tensile energized can be used with lamb, and also woven cord can be used with hogs.

These costs consist of the cost of tools and devices for building fence, as well as labor. Gates are not included in the estimates. Barbed wire fence Materials for the barbed cord fence (see Table 2) are comparable to the woven cord fence except that 5 strands of 12-gauge barbed cord are substituted for the woven cable and also single hair of barbed cable.
Wire tension on this fence is kept with springtimes and cog type tensioning develops. Electrified polywire fencing (for indoor usage only) The polywire fence (see Table 5) utilizes one strand of polywire. With the exception of completion blog posts, fiberglass rod posts are made use of and also spaced 40 feet apart. One-fourth of the cost of an electrical energizer is included in the price of 1,320 feet of fencing, thinking that such an unit would certainly be made use of to invigorate at the very least a mile of fencing.

Annual possession costs for each and every kind of fence are revealed in Table 6. In enhancement to the initial product, labor and also building prices, owners need to identify devaluation and also upkeep expenses needed over the beneficial life of the fence.
The non-wire/tape elements have an estimated life of 25 years; the polywire and also polytape will likely last regarding four to five years. Based on these estimates, the yearly ownership cost for a polywire or polytape fence is approximately $0. 06-$0. 07 per foot. Chapter 359A.18 of the Iowa Code states: A legal surround Iowa will contain: Three rails of excellent significant product secured in or to great considerable messages not greater than 10 feet apart.

Three wires, barbed with not less than thirty-six iron barbs of 2 points each, or twenty-six iron barbs of 4 points each, on each pole of wire, or of 4 cords, two thus barbed and also 2 smooth, the cables to be strongly fastened to posts not greater than 2 poles apart, with not less than 2 keeps in between articles, or with posts even more than one pole apart without such stays, the leading cord to be not more than fifty-four neither less than forty-eight inches in elevation.
A fencing including four parallel, coated steel, smooth high-tensile cord which satisfies demands embraced by ASTM International (previously, American Society of Screening and also Materials) consisting of yet not limited to requirements relating to the grade, tensile strength, prolongation, measurements and also tolerances of the cable. The cord must be strongly secured to plastic, metal or wood messages firmly planted in the earth.
The top wire will be at the very least forty inches in elevation. Any type of various other type of fencing which the fencing viewers consider to be equal to a lawful fencing or which satisfies the criteria established by the department of agriculture as well as land stewardship by rule as equal to an authorized fence.
